Extended Release (ER) prescription drugs are much like sustained-release formulations but offer a a lot longer period of motion. ER drugs are designed to release the drug slowly and gradually in excess of an extended period of time, ordinarily twelve to 24 hrs, allowing for patients to consider their medication when day-to-day.
